# Shrinkray CLI — Build Provenance

Shrinkray, our batch image-resizing CLI, builds exclusively through the Fenwick hermetic runner. Binaries for all three platforms come from one pipeline run; cross-compiled outputs share a manifest. Release manager checklist: verify the runner attestation, confirm codec libraries match pinned versions, and ensure the smoke suite resized the reference corpus without checksum drift. Hotfixes follow the same path — no exceptions. The canonical build token for the current release is appended below.

build token for tahop-fafof: htk14_2d55df8101eccc

Handover note — Crumbwheel order cutoffs.

Welcome aboard. The bakery cutoff rule in Crumbwheel closes same-day orders at 14:00 local to each storefront, not UTC — this has bitten us twice. Holiday overrides live in the calendar service and take precedence silently, so always check there first when a cutoff looks wrong. To unlock the calendar service's admin console after a restart, enter the recovery passphrase below.

vault phrase of bagap-bahaf = silion-pelox-sorox-casdor-quenwyn-fraax-eliox-praael-kelion-quenvan-kasox-rusael-norius-belvan

Handover — Canteen Arrangements

Hanna, quick note before I'm off: our canteen on Level 1 is shared with Bryster Analytics next door, so expect their staff at lunch. Our people can charge meals to the Ostrel Labs account at the till. The connecting corridor between the two buildings stays locked outside 11:30–14:00. If an assistant needs through at other times, the corridor keypad code is below.

door code, yagap-bahof: bdg-O-05

## Runbook: Canary Gating Rules

For the weekly sync: Driftgate canaries promote automatically only when error rate stays under 0.5% and p95 latency within 10% of baseline for 30 minutes. Any manual override must be logged in the gating table with a reason. Rollbacks reset the observation window. Gate decisions and override history are stored in the deploy-metrics database; query it using the connection string below.

primary connection of hadup-kajeg = clickhouse://rusath_svc:lTa6pgZ@db-a477.plorvaforge.corp:5432/oliox